Sylvie Grosjean is a full professor at the University of Ottawa and holds the International Francophonie Research Chair on Digital Health Technologies. Her research focuses on the design and implementation of telehealth innovations, including mHealth applications and remote monitoring, as well as the role of technologies in organizational communication and clinical decision-making. Grosjean employs qualitative methods such as organizational ethnography, visual methods, and narrative interviews to develop collaborative approaches in organizational contexts. She is committed to co-design and participatory design in her projects which aim to integrate innovative communication practices in healthcare settings. Her research also emphasizes the coordination of care and the deployment of Artificial Intelligence within telemedicine. Grosjean has supervised several graduate students, including Maryame Ichiba, and continues to contribute significantly to the field of digital health technologies.
